Impeachment complaint filed against Abalos
Iloilo Vice Governor Rolex Suplico filed an impeachment complaint Thursday afternoon against Commission on Elections (COMELEC) chairman Benjamin Abalos Sr. who has been accused of offering bribes to a Cabinet official and a businessman for an allegedly overpriced deal with China.
Suplico claimed to have a “solid” case against the Comelec chairman based on the testimonies of De Venecia III and Neri, including what he called a “series of unfortunate incidents,” such as Abalos’ presence at a number of meetings on the NBN project.
